区块链是一种去中心化的分布式账本技术,通过加密算法将交易记录按照时间戳和顺序链接成一个不可篡改的链表。它的去中心化特性使得没有中央机构控制权,所有参与者共同维护和验证账本的一致性。区块链被广泛应用于数字货币的交易中,其中钱包是存储和管理数字货币的工具。
区块链钱包的发展可以追溯到比特币的诞生。比特币是第一个基于区块链技术的数字货币,为了方便用户管理和使用比特币,钱包应运而生。最早的比特币钱包以软件形式存在,用户可以通过下载并安装在自己的设备上使用。
随着比特币的普及和区块链技术的发展,出现了更多种类的区块链钱包。第二代钱包采用了多重签名技术提高安全性,同时支持多种数字货币。第三代钱包则提供了更多的用户友好功能,如交易提醒、地址簿等。同时,随着移动设备的普及,出现了移动端的区块链钱包,方便用户随时随地管理数字货币。
目前,区块链钱包发展到第四代,除了支持多种数字货币外,还提供了更加便捷和安全的功能,如硬件钱包、离线签名等。区块链钱包的发展趋势是更加注重用户体验和安全性,为用户提供更加便捷和可信赖的数字货币管理工具。
区块链钱包的核心技术是加密技术和密钥管理。加密技术保证了用户的数字货币在传输和存储过程中的安全性,密钥管理则用于验证用户的身份和控制其交易。
加密技术包括非对称加密和对称加密两种方式。非对称加密使用公钥和私钥进行加密和解密,公钥用于加密数据,私钥用于解密数据。对称加密使用同一个密钥进行加密和解密,密钥需要在用户间进行安全传输。
密钥管理涉及到用户的身份验证和数字签名。用户通过私钥对交易进行签名,其他用户可以通过公钥验证签名的有效性。同时,钱包也需要安全地管理用户的私钥,防止私钥泄露导致资产损失。
随着区块链技术的不断发展和应用广泛,区块链钱包也将迎来更多创新和发展。未来的区块链钱包可能会更加智能化和个性化,为用户提供更加定制化的数字货币管理服务。
例如,随着智能合约技术的发展,未来的区块链钱包可能会集成智能合约功能,用户可以直接在钱包中进行合约的创建和执行。同时,随着区块链技术在物联网和供应链等领域的应用,区块链钱包也可能扩展到更多领域,提供多样化的服务。
此外,用户隐私和数据安全也是未来区块链钱包发展的重要方向。针对区块链上交易信息公开透明的特点,未来的钱包可能会提供更好的隐私保护机制,保护用户的身份和交易隐私。
综上所述,区块链钱包的历史背景可以追溯到比特币的出现。随着区块链技术的发展,区块链钱包从最初的软件形式发展到现在的多样化和功能丰富的第四代钱包。区块链钱包的核心技术包括加密技术和密钥管理,它们保证了用户数字货币的安全性和私密性。未来,区块链钱包将继续发展,变得更加智能化、个性化,并注重用户隐私和数据安全的保护。